The oscillation of a diatomic chain with on-site potential

摘要: 根据声学模的定义,明确了具有在位势的一维双原子链的晶格振动不存在声学模.讨论了具有在位势的一维双原子链晶格振动的低频支长波模振动图像,得到原胞中两种原子运动的振幅不再一致,低频支长波模不再是原胞质心的运动,且两种原子运动的振幅比随在位势的增大而单调增大.

Abstract: The dispersion relation of a diatomic chain has two branches. For a diatomic chain with on-site potential, both these modes are optical ones, because there is also a natural gap for small wave numbers in the lower branch of dispersion relation. In the case of long wavelength "acoustic" modes, the amplitudes of the two atoms within each cell are not identical. The long wavelength "acoustic" modes are not the motions of the center of mass.
